基本信息

《加拿大渔业和水产科学杂志》是水产科学多学科领域的主要出版工具。它发表观点(综合、评论和重新评估)、讨论(评论和回复)、文章和快速通信,涉及组学、细胞、生物体、种群、生态系统或影响水生系统的过程的当前研究。该杂志旨在扩大,修改,质疑,或重新定向在渔业和水产科学领域积累的知识。
